Jax4 Posted July 15, 2008 Report Posted July 15, 2008 This one took adding Friday night 7/18 which I preferred to hold off on until the end of the week. Went up to $55 in combinations of 1, 2 and 3 nights starting Tuesday night, then just decided to add the 4th night. Still, best 3* quality room to book direct near ONT was $109 so a solid value nonetheless. Hyatt Place was $135, Ayres (2.5*) $109-119, this Marriott direct is essentially $149 during the week. Doubletree $149-159, Hilton north of I-10 around the same. Then you get down to the 2* level in the $75-90 range. As the maximum value of points in hotel loyalty programs typically is no better than around $10 to maybe $15 night, depending on your level in program, Priceline is still one of the best values out there.$49/night - 4 nights - $196 or $228.90 with fees - just over an inclusive $57/night.
